If you are new to the game, please read the following. Werewolf Lite is a game of survival. Your main goal, no matter your role, is to survive. There are two sides to every game. The Villagers and Seer on one side. The Werewolves on the other. Each side's goal is to destroy the other. The game is played with seventeen players. Out of these seventeen, five are given a special role. Four are Werewolves, and One is a Seer. Their Identities must remain secret. If the Seer's identity is revealed, the Werewolves may hunt their most dangerous enemy. If the Werewolves' identities are revealed, the village will surely lynch the monsters.
The Game is divided into two sections. Day and Night. The game begins with a Night session. During the Night, the Werewolves hunt one person, and the Seer may discover the role of one villager. During the day, the villagers must decide who is responsible for the murder of the night past.

Rules:
There shall be up to seventeen (17) players. Special Roles will be handed out after the last person signs up and the GM is good and ready. Only Special Roles will get an PM.
The game will then proceed to a Night deadline.
The game is divided into two periods - night and day. For practical reasons these two periods take place at the same time, from one update till the next.
Each day, all players gather and decide to lynch one of the players - the person they think is most likely to be a werewolf. Each night, the werewolves decide who to kill. In each 24 hour period, the village will lynch, and the werewolves will hunt. The villagers can try to lynch multiple people by creating a glorious, Lemeard-approved, TIE, and the werewolves can also decide not to hunt anyone at all at night. Beware of Crovaxian slips as well!
Winning:
The werewolves win if they manage to reach parity with the villagers.
The villagers and seer win if they manage to kill all the werewolves.
Player Roles:
Villagers: Normal people that came to pay their respects. Nothing special about them.
Werewolf: A village that when he returned decided that he did not like certain people and wanted to kill them before they left. Due to the fact that they are greatly outnumbered, they can't just leave after they killed him, so they need to thin the numbers enough so they can escape. Once per Night they send in a order on who to Hunt.
Seer: A villager that happened to take detailed notes of who hated who long ago. However he does not remember it, but he found his books and can spend the night reading over the long notes to find out what a person's role is. Once per night he sends in an order on who to read in his books to figure out what a person's real mission is.
